
Alienware AW2523HF 24.5" FHD 360Hz Gaming Monitor
24.5" FHD Fast IPS esports monitor with a blistering 360Hz refresh rate and 0.5ms response time. Features a redesigned hexagonal base for maximizing desk space and a retractable headset hanger.

Pros
- 360Hz refresh rate (via DisplayPort) offers elite-tier motion clarity for CS2 and Valorant
- Fast IPS panel combines speed (0.5ms) with much better colors/viewing angles than TN panels
- Compact hexagonal base and retractable headset hanger are designed specifically for esports desks
- Includes a rich USB hub (4 downstream ports) for connecting peripherals effortlessly
- Excellent factory calibration (99% sRGB) ensures accurate colors out of the box
Cons
- HDMI ports are limited to 255Hz; you must use DisplayPort for the full 360Hz experience
- Lacks VESA DisplayHDR certification; 'Smart HDR' is largely software-based with no local dimming
- 1080p resolution provides lower pixel density compared to 1440p options
- No built-in speakers
